The total expenditure of a family, on different activities in a month, is shown in the pie-chart. The categories and their approximate shares are: Food 35%, Loan 20%, Transport 14%, Education 21%, Leisure 7%, Others 3%. The extra money spent on education as compared to transport (in percent) is ______. A. 5 B. 33.3 C. 50 D. 100

Answer: Education spending is 50% more than Transport spending. Answer: C. 50

  1. Identify Education and Transport shares from the pie chart: Education share = 21%, Transport share = 14%
  2. Calculate percentage excess of Education over Transport: % excess = (21 - 14) / 14 x 100 = 7 / 14 x 100 = 0.5 x 100 = 50%
